Strategia di ottimizzazione delle prestazioni nei casinò moderni – una guida tecnica al “Zero‑Lag Gaming”

(Word count: 2759)

Introduzione (≈230 parole)

Il panorama dei casinò online è oggi dominato da un’esigenza di velocità che ricorda la corsa dei circuiti di Formula 1: ogni millisecondo conta quando un giocatore decide di piazzare una scommessa su una slot a 5 × 3 o su un tavolo di blackjack live. La percezione di “lag” non è solo un fastidio estetico; influisce direttamente sul ritorno al giocatore (RTP), sulla volatilità percepita e sul tasso di conversione delle offerte promozionali. Un ritardo anche di 50 ms può far perdere l’opportunità di attivare un bonus di benvenuto del 100 % con wagering ridotto, spingendo l’utente verso la concorrenza più reattiva.

In questo contesto Leaddogmarketing.Com, sito di recensioni e ranking indipendente per operatori AAMS e piattaforme internazionali, ha raccolto le migliori pratiche del settore e le ha messe a disposizione dei professionisti del gaming digitale 【https://leaddogmarketing.com/】. Questa guida tecnica spiega come pianificare strategicamente l’implementazione di Zero‑Lag Gaming nei casinò moderni, evidenziando gli aspetti più critici da considerare durante la fase di progettazione e durante le operazioni quotidiane.

(Word count: 230)

Architettura di rete a bassa latenza (≈360 parole)

Una rete efficiente è la spina dorsale del Zero‑Lag Gaming. Analizzeremo i componenti chiave da considerare nella progettazione dell’infrastruttura fisica e logica dei data‑center che ospitano i server dei giochi online.

Scelta dei provider di connettività e peering diretto (Word count: 180)

  • Valutare ISP con presenza PoP (Point of Presence) vicino alle principali capitali europee (Milano, Parigi, Londra).
  • Preferire accordi di peering diretto con CDN come Cloudflare o Akamai per ridurre il numero di hop IP.
  • Monitorare il jitter medio (< 5 ms) e la perdita pacchetti (< 0,1 %).

Un caso reale è il casinò live “Royal Spin”, che ha migrato il traffico RTP‑critical verso un ISP con backbone a fibra ottica a 100 Gbps, passando da 120 ms a 38 ms di latenza media per i giocatori italiani AAMS‑certificati.

Topologia distribuita vs monolitica (Word count: 180)

Caratteristica Architettura monolitica Architettura distribuita (micro‑servizi)
Tempo medio di risposta 85 ms (picchi fino a 150 ms) 32 ms (picchi < 60 ms)
Scalabilità Limitata a scaling verticale Auto‑scaling orizzontale per regione
Resilienza Punto unico di guasto Tolleranza ai guasti multi‑zona
Manutenzione Interruzioni programmate obbligatorie Deploy zero‑downtime per singolo servizio

Distribuire i motori delle slot “Mega Fortune” su tre regioni (EU‑West‑1, EU‑Central‑1, EU‑North‑1) consente ai giocatori su dispositivi mobili di ricevere aggiornamenti grafici entro 25 ms dal click sul “Spin”. La topologia distribuita riduce inoltre l’impatto dei picchi dovuti a jackpot progressivi da € 500 000 a € 5 M, evitando colli di bottiglia sul nodo centrale.

(Word count: 360)

Ottimizzazione del motore grafico e rendering (≈330 parole)

Il rendering delle slot machine o dei tavoli da gioco deve avvenire in tempo reale senza sacrificare la qualità visiva. Le seguenti tecniche sono ormai standard nei casinò mobile premium:

  1. WebGL + shader pre‑compilati – riducono il tempo di compilazione shader del 40 % rispetto a soluzioni basate su Canvas 2D.
  2. Texture atlasing – combinano più sprite in un unico file per diminuire le richieste HTTP/2; ideale per giochi con molte paylines come “Starburst XXX”.
  3. Level‑of‑Detail dinamico – abbassa la risoluzione delle particelle quando il frame rate scende sotto i 45 FPS su dispositivi Android con RAM < 4 GB, mantenendo l’RTP stabile al 96,5 %.

Un esempio concreto proviene dal casinò “Lucky Horizon”, che ha introdotto un motore grafico basato su Unity’s Burst Compiler per le sue slot “Volcano Riches”. Il risultato è stato una diminuzione della latenza dal comando “Spin” al risultato finale da 120 ms a 58 ms sui dispositivi iOS più diffusi, aumentando il tasso di conversione delle promozioni “Free Spins” del 12 %.

Infine, l’uso di GPU offloading tramite Vulkan API permette ai giochi live dealer di trasmettere video HD con latenza inferiore a 30 ms, migliorando l’esperienza del casinò live per gli utenti che preferiscono il betting su roulette europea con payout garantito dal certificato AAMS.

(Word count: 330)

Gestione efficiente delle code di messaggi (≈295 parole)

Le code RabbitMQ/Kafka sono spesso il punto critico dove si accumulano ritardi nella trasmissione degli eventi di gioco. Una configurazione ottimale deve tenere conto sia della priorità degli eventi (spin, vincita, aggiornamento saldo) sia della capacità delle consumer group durante i picchi di traffico (“big win” events).

Priorità dinamiche

  • High‑Priority: risultati immediati degli spin e conferme jackpot; TTL ≤ 20 ms.
  • Medium‑Priority: aggiornamenti saldo post‑wagering; TTL ≤ 100 ms.
  • Low‑Priority: notifiche push promozionali; TTL ≤ 500 ms.

Implementando dead‑letter queues per messaggi non consegnati entro i limiti sopra indicati, si evita il blocco della pipeline principale e si garantisce che le vincite vengano accreditate entro il secondo successivo al click dell’utente.

Batching intelligente

Aggregare eventi simili in batch da massimo 10 messaggi riduce il numero totale di round‑trip TCP del 35 %, ma richiede una logica server‑side capace di decomprimere rapidamente i batch senza introdurre overhead superiore a 5 ms per batch elaborato.

Meccanismi di back‑pressure

Utilizzare consumer lag metrics per attivare automaticamente scaling dei pod Kubernetes dedicati alle code Kafka; quando il lag supera i 2000 offset si avvia un nuovo consumer group con capacità raddoppiata fino al ritorno sotto soglia critica. Questo approccio ha permesso al casinò “Fortune Palace” di gestire più di 2 milioni di eventi al minuto durante una campagna “Mega Bonus” senza alcun ritardo percepito dagli utenti mobile Android e iOS.

(Word count: 295)

Bilanciamento del carico e scalabilità automatica (≈285 parole)

Un corretto bilanciatore garantisce che nessun nodo venga sovraccaricato durante i picchi di traffico (“big win” events). Gli algoritmi tradizionali round‑robin o least‑connections non sono sufficienti quando la variabilità del carico dipende dalla volatilità della slot (alta volatilità → picchi improvvisi).

Algoritmi LRU/LFU avanzati

  • LRU (Least Recently Used) mantiene attivi i nodi che hanno servito le ultime richieste high‑frequency, rimuovendo quelli inattivi per ridurre la latenza media del percorso dati.
  • LFU (Least Frequently Used) è ideale per distribuire equamente le richieste tra server che gestiscono giochi low‑volatility come “Classic Fruits”.

Metriche predittive basate su AI

Un modello time‑series alimentato da dati storici sulle sessioni giornaliere prevede picchi futuri con errore medio assoluto < 3%. Quando la previsione supera il valore soglia (es.: > 8000 rps), lo scaler automatico aggiunge istanze EC2 ottimizzate per compute intensive tasks (c5n.large) entro meno di 30 secondi.

Nel caso pratico del casinò “Sunrise Slots”, l’integrazione dell’AI predictor ha ridotto gli errori HTTP 502 del 78 % durante le campagne “Weekend Jackpot”, mantenendo la latenza complessiva sotto gli 40 ms anche quando più di 150k giocatori simultanei hanno attivato la modalità free spin con wagering zero.

(Word count: 285)

Caching intelligenti lato client & server (≈275 parole)

Il caching è uno strumento potente ma delicato nei giochi d’azzardo dove l’integrità dei dati è sacra. Un errore nella sincronizzazione può generare discrepanze tra il credito mostrato al giocatore e quello realmente registrato nel ledger finanziario certificato AAMS.

Cache read‑through con validazione hash‐based

1️⃣ Il client richiede lo stato della sessione; se presente nella cache locale IndexedDB viene restituito immediatamente (< 5 ms).
2️⃣ In parallelo il server invia un hash SHA‑256 del record corrente; se coincide con quello memorizzato localmente la cache rimane valida, altrimenti viene invalidata e ricaricata dal database NewSQL.

Questa strategia è stata adottata da “Galaxy Casino”, dove le slot “Cosmic Wins” hanno mostrato una riduzione della latenza percepita da 120 ms a 48 ms senza alcuna perdita nella coerenza dei saldi post‐spin – cruciale quando si gestiscono bonus progressive fino a € 10 000 con wagering limitato al 5× del deposito iniziale.

Cache lato server con TTL dinamico

Per le richieste frequenti come le tabelle payout delle slot a bassa volatilità si utilizza Redis Cluster con TTL variabile in base alla frequenza d’uso (da 30 s a 300 s). La coerenza è garantita tramite write‑through verso il layer persistenza NewSQL descritta nella sezione successiva, evitando così situazioni in cui un jackpot progressivo venga visualizzato erronemente chiuso prima della sua realizzazione effettiva.

(Word count: 275)

Persistenza dei dati con latenza quasi zero (≈260 parole)

Database tradizionali possono diventare colli di bottiglia quando devono scrivere risultati di spin in tempo reale. Per mantenere una latenza inferiore ai 10 ms dalla conclusione dello spin alla scrittura definitiva nel ledger finanziario è necessario adottare architetture NewSQL o soluzioni multi‑master replicate ad alta velocità.

Confronto sistemi (word count table)

Sistema Tipo Latency write* Consistency model Use case tipico
CockroachDB NewSQL ≈8 ms Strong Transazioni finanziarie AAMS
TiDB NewSQL + OLAP ≈12 ms Strong/Transactional Analisi realtime dei KPI gaming
Memcached + MySQL Replication Cache + RDBMS ≈15 ms Eventual Session state non critico
DynamoDB Global Tables NoSQL ≈9 ms Strong (per item) Salvataggio bonus & premi instantanei

Le piattaforme leader come “Jackpot City Live” hanno scelto CockroachDB per gestire simultaneamente più milioni di transazioni giornaliere legate a metodi di pagamento diversi (carte Visa/Mastercard, wallet crypto). Grazie al geo‑partitioning, le scritture provenienti dall’UE vengono indirizzate a nodi situati in Frankfurt, mantenendo la latenza sotto i 7 ms anche durante le ore picco del weekend europeo quando si attivano promozioni “Deposit Bonus up to €500”.

(Word count: 260)

Monitoraggio continuo & alerting proattivo (≈252 parole)

Un sistema di osservabilità completo è indispensabile per rilevare anomalie prima che impattino l’esperienza utente. I KPI specifici al gaming includono: latency media dello spin, tasso errori HTTP/5xx, percentuale drop frame nelle stream live dealer e throughput delle code Kafka/Broker.

Dashboard KPI consigliata

  • Latency Spin – valore medio < 40 ms; soglia allarme > 80 ms per > 5% delle richieste entro ultimi 5 minuti.
  • Error Rate – < 0,05% totale; alert su incremento > 0,02% in intervallo < 2 minuti.
  • Throughput Queue – target ≥ 10k msg/s; avviso se lag > 2000 offset persistente più de​lta >30 sec.*

OpenTelemetry integrato con Grafana Loki consente tracing distribuito dall’interfaccia client fino al layer persistenza NewSQL, fornendo insight granulari sui colli di bottiglia microsecondo dopo microsecondo. Inoltre Leaddogmarketing.Com utilizza questi dati nelle proprie valutazioni comparative tra operatori AAMS ed internazionali, evidenziando quali piattaforme mantengono costantemente SLA sotto i 30 ms per esperienze mobile-first su Android 12+.

Un esempio pratico riguarda “Royal Flush Live”, dove l’attivazione automatica dell’alert “Latency Spike” ha permesso al team DevOps di intervenire entro 45 secondi, evitando perdite stimate pari a € 12k derivanti da sessioni abbandonate durante una promozione “Free Bet €20”.

(Word count: 252)

Best practice operative & governance della performance (≈272 parole) ***

L’ottimizzazione non finisce con il lancio della piattaforma; richiede processi strutturati per audit periodici, test A/B continui e piani di disaster recovery focalizzati sulla latenza massima ammissibile.*

Checklist operativa trimestrale

1️⃣ Verifica integrità della topologia CDN mediante ping test da almeno cinque punti geografici diversi.

2️⃣ Esecuzione stress test sui microservizi game engine simulando 100k concurrent spins.

3️⃣ Revisione policy cache TTL in base ai risultati delle analisi A/B su bonus “Instant Win”.

4️⃣ Aggiornamento firmware switch data center per garantire supporto a IEEE 802.3bz (40GbE).

Governance della performance

  • SLA interno: latency ≤ 30 ms per operazioni critiche (spin + payout), uptime ≥99,99% su servizi core.
  • Committee cross‑functional composto da ingegneria backend, security & compliance AAMS e product management.
  • Report mensile condiviso con stakeholder esterni tramite Leaddogmarketing.Com per benchmarking pubblico contro competitor leader.

Il piano disaster recovery prevede replica sincrona dei dati finanziari su tre zone geografiche diverse; in caso di degrado della rete superiore al 15%, le istanze secondarie subentrano automaticamente mantenendo la latenza entro i limiti contrattuali stabiliti dalle licenze AAMS italiane e dalle normative UE sui pagamenti elettronici.*

Implementando queste pratiche operative gli operatori possono trasformare la gestione della performance da attività reattiva a processo proattivo continuo—un vantaggio competitivo decisivo nel mercato altamente dinamico dei casinò live e mobile.*

(Word count: 272)

Conclusione (≈200 parole)

Implementare una strategia Zero‑Lag Gaming non è solo una questione tecnologica ma anche organizzativa; richiede un approccio integrato che parte dall’infrastruttura fisica fino alle politiche operative quotidiane. Seguendo i passaggi descritti in questa guida – dalla scelta della rete al monitoraggio continuo – gli operatori possono ridurre drasticamente la latenza percepita dal giocatore, migliorare la soddisfazione dell’utente finale e incrementare significativamente il fatturato del casinò digitale.*

Leaddogmarketing.Com continua a fornire analisi indipendenti sui provider più performanti e sulle soluzioni software capaci di mantenere tempi inferiori ai 30 ms, dimostrando che la pianificazione strategica anticipata ed il continuo affinamento basato sui dati reali sono le chiavi del successo nel mondo dei giochi d’azzardo online.*

(Word count: 200)